คำถามติดแท็ก relationship-class

2
ใช้หรือไม่ใช้คลาสความสัมพันธ์?
ฉันกำลังสร้างฐานข้อมูลรัฐบาลจากข้อมูลจำนวนมหาศาล ตอนนี้ฉันกำลังติดตามแนวทางมาตรฐานของรูปแบบข้อมูลรัฐบาลท้องถิ่นของ ESRI แต่ปรับเปลี่ยนให้เหมาะกับความต้องการและความต้องการของรัฐบาลเฉพาะ ฉันสังเกตเห็นว่าในรูปแบบข้อมูลรัฐบาลท้องถิ่น ESRI ใช้คลาสความสัมพันธ์จำนวนมาก ฉันเคยใช้คลาสความสัมพันธ์ในอดีต แต่มีแนวโน้มที่จะหลีกเลี่ยงพวกเขา นี่เป็นเพราะฉันมักจะไม่เห็นเหตุผลว่าทำไมฉันต้องการคุณลักษณะเกี่ยวกับรูปร่างในตารางแยกต่างหากจากคลาสคุณลักษณะ สำหรับข้อมูลเกือบทั้งหมดที่ฉันกำลังรวบรวมฉันยังคงไม่เห็นเหตุผลของสิ่งนี้ สำหรับพัสดุผ้าฉันเห็นเหตุผลบางอย่างที่มันจะมีประโยชน์ แต่ก็ยังเชื่อว่ามันจะเป็นการดีที่สุดที่จะคงคุณลักษณะไว้ในระดับคุณลักษณะโดยตรง ตอนนี้เพื่อความชัดเจนฉันจะใช้คลาสความสัมพันธ์เพื่ออ้างอิงคลาสคุณสมบัติกับคลาสคุณสมบัติคำถามนี้มีการระบุเพิ่มเติมว่าทำไมฉันจะเก็บข้อมูลในตารางที่ไม่ใช่เชิงพื้นที่ที่สามารถจัดเก็บในคลาสคุณลักษณะได้อย่างง่ายดาย ขอบคุณมากสำหรับทุกคนที่เข้ามา!

4
ด้วย arcpy ฉันจะตรวจสอบคลาสความสัมพันธ์ในไฟล์ GDB (หรือฉันไม่สามารถ) ได้อย่างไร
ฉันต้องการตรวจสอบคลาสความสัมพันธ์ในไฟล์ GDB เนื่องจากผู้ใช้สคริปต์ของฉันอาจมีสิทธิ์ใช้งานระดับ ArcView เท่านั้นพวกเขาจะไม่สามารถจัดการสคีมาของคลาสคุณลักษณะ (โดยเฉพาะเพื่อเพิ่มฟิลด์) ที่อยู่ในพื้นที่ทำงานที่มีคลาสความสัมพันธ์ ฉันจะตรวจสอบการมีอยู่ของคลาสความสัมพันธ์เพื่อให้ฉันสามารถจัดทำเอกสารพวกเขาหลีกเลี่ยงพวกเขาเป็นโปรแกรมและอนุญาตให้สคริปต์เพื่อดำเนินการต่อ

1
ความสัมพันธ์ของเซิร์ฟเวอร์ SQL ใน ArcSDE?
ฉันใช้ ArcSDE 10 พร้อม SQL Server 2008 R2 Standard Edition ฉันใหม่กับ SDE และ SQL Server แต่ฉันเข้าใจว่า SQL Server มีความสามารถในการสร้างความสัมพันธ์ระหว่างตารางและรักษากฎการอ้างอิงความสมบูรณ์ ArcGIS มีคลาสความสัมพันธ์ที่ทำหน้าที่คล้ายกัน แต่คลาสของความสัมพันธ์ไม่มีคุณสมบัติทั้งหมดของความสัมพันธ์ของ SQL และไม่ส่งผลให้เกิดความสัมพันธ์ของ SQL ในฐานข้อมูล ArcSDE เป็นไปได้ไหมที่จะสร้างคลาสความสัมพันธ์ใน ArcGIS สำหรับฐานข้อมูล ArcSDE และสร้างความสัมพันธ์สำหรับตารางเดียวกันใน SQL Server ด้วยการทำเช่นนั้นฉันจะสามารถใช้ความสัมพันธ์เหล่านี้ได้ไม่ว่าฉันจะทำงานกับข้อมูลใน ArcGIS หรือใน SQL Server Management Studio ความสัมพันธ์ทั้งสองประเภทจะขัดแย้งกันหรือขัดขวางการทำงานหรือไม่?
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.